Alexander Pettit 1767–1842 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 19 Feb 1767

Birth Location: Carroll, Maryland, USA

Death Date: 16 Sep 1842

Death Location: Claiborne, Mississippi, USA

Father: James Jr.

Mother: Martha MCCUNE

Spouse(s): Rosanna Nixon

Children(s): Rebecca Petit

The story of Alexander Pettit began in 1767 in Carroll, Maryland, USA. Alexander Pettit married Rosanna Nixon, and had children including Rebecca Petit. Alexander Pettit passed away in 1842 in Claiborne, Mississippi, USA.
